Snowmobile Fanatics banner
mach z
1-1 of 1 Results
  1. Ski-Doo
    I just purchased an 07 Mach Z X 1000 it has 2400 miles on it. I am just curious if anyone knows specific issues I should be aware of other than the Uni filters preventing belt dust being sucked up into the intake? Also, I rode the thing 7 miles after I bought it and it overheated. Not very...
1-1 of 1 Results